WTF.... I didn't know you can clip it like that!!! I always just hung the gascap by wrapping it in between the gas cover and the quater panel area's small crack opening....

Oh, and i did notice the thing about the gas pump nozzle, and i figured the reason is that our car's gas hose that connect to the tank is some what designed like a sink drain pipe. When I had vandals pour in sugar down my gas tank, i noticed all of them got caught on the U bottom part of the pipe, so it never got into the gas tank, it just stayed with in the pipe around the U area.
